Southwestern Oklahoma is a hidden gem in the state of Oklahoma. Known for its diverse landscapes, this region offers a mix of rugged mountains, serene lakes, and expansive prairies. The Wichita Mountains Wildlife Refuge is a must-visit, home to free-roaming bison, elk, and longhorn cattle. It's also a hiker's paradise with trails that offer stunning views and opportunities to spot unique wildlife. For history buffs, the area is rich in Native American culture and western heritage. Visit the Museum of the Great Plains in Lawton to learn about the history and culture of the Plains Indians and early settlers. The Fort Sill National Historic Landmark and Museum provides a fascinating glimpse into military history, with exhibits dating back to the Indian Wars. Nature lovers will enjoy a visit to Lake Lawtonka and Lake Ellsworth, perfect for fishing, boating, and picnicking. The Quartz Mountain Nature Park is another highlight, offering outdoor activities such as rock climbing, hiking, and bird watching. With its clear skies, the park is also an excellent spot for stargazing. No trip to Southwestern Oklahoma is complete without experiencing the local cuisine. Savor traditional Oklahoma barbecue, fried catfish, and other Southern delicacies in the region's charming small towns. Whether you're an adventurer, a history enthusiast, or simply looking to relax in nature, Southwestern Oklahoma has something for everyone.
